Pop star Lady Gaga brought one of her concerts to a halt on Tuesday after two fans got into a fight.

The singer was performing her hit "Monster" when she suddenly stopped singing and yelled, "Stop the music ... stop the fighting ... do not fight at this show".

Gaga, who was performing at the Verizon Centre in Washington, apologised for the interruption before asking security if the commotion had been sorted.

“Is she okay, are they both okay, I don’t know who hit who," Gaga said.

"I'm sorry, I just don't want you to fight.

"Only fake monster fighting, okay?"

The show got back underway after the singer asked the crowd; "Do you think I am sexy?"
